Tragic Shooting Incident at CRPF Camp in Assam Claims Lives of Two Soldiers

A tragic shooting incident at the Katimari CRPF camp in Assam has resulted in the deaths of two soldiers and the suicide of the shooter. The event unfolded early in the morning, with multiple casualties reported. Local authorities are investigating the circumstances surrounding this distressing occurrence. Shooting Incident in Nagaon District

In a distressing event at the Katimari CRPF camp located in Nagaon district, a CRPF personnel reportedly opened fire on his colleagues, resulting in the deaths of two soldiers. Following the incident, the shooter took his own life. The deceased have been identified as SI/GD Ramanwal Singh Yadav and HV/GD Vishnu Prasad Baghel. Additionally, the shooter has been named as Assistant Sub-Inspector (ASI/GD) Ballani Premabaram. Another injured soldier, identified as ASI/Mane Govind Shripul, sustained serious injuries during the shooting, which occurred around 7:30 AM within the premises of the 34th Battalion CRPF camp.


According to local police, the incident was reported to them, prompting a swift response. ASP (Crime) Abotani Dole confirmed that four individuals were affected by the gunfire. Tragically, two soldiers died at the scene, one succumbed to injuries at the hospital, and another was transported to Guwahati for urgent medical care.
